When the final final whistle blows and a college athlete hangs up her jersey for the last time, what happens next?
For Julia, an Athletes InterVarsity Alumna from UW-River Falls, it was a challenging transition. Saying goodbye to her team, managing an unfamiliar routine, and embracing her new grad school environment meant following Jesus into uncertainty. But God had been preparing her to take courageous steps of faith like these since joining the UW-River Falls Women's Basketball team during her junior year. It was here, as a brand new member of the team, that Julia planted a team Bible study; a ministry that has continued to grow and flourish since she graduated in 2024. It may not look quite the same, but Julia is still courageously saying "yes" to Jesus in her new context and learning what it means to lean into her identity as a child of God and follower of Jesus.
